1.Rapid Diagnosis of Surgical Anaerobic Infection with Gas Chroma-tography
Academic Journal of Second Military Medical University 1981;0(03):-
One hundred fifteen surgical specimens were studied by gram-stain, aerobic and anaerobic cultu- res, as well as gas chromatography, respectively. One hundred seventy six strains, including ninety five aerobic and eighty one anaerobic strains, were isolated. The results suggested that diagnosis of anaerobic bacteria by gas chromatography could be accomplished within 1 h. The specificity of this method was 98.11% and the sensitivity, 90.47%. In addition, the early identification of anaerobic bacteria could be made also. There is higher value for rapid diagnosis of anaerobic infection with gas chromatography.
2.Correlation between serum uric acid level and heart failure severity in patients with chronic pulmonary heart disease
Chinese Journal of cardiovascular Rehabilitation Medicine 2017;26(2):135-138
Objective: To explore correlation between serum uric acid (UA) level and heart failure severity in patients with chronic pulmonary heart disease (CPHD).Methods:According to New York Heart Association (NYHA) cardiac function classification, a total of 98 CPHD patients were divided into class I~II group (n=36), class III group (n=31) and class IV group (n=31).Another 30 healthy subjects were enrolled as healthy control group simultaneously.Serum UA level was measured in all groups.Real time three-dimensional color Doppler echocardiography was used to measure left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F) and left ventricular end-diastolic dimension (LVEDd), and the results were compared among all groups.Results: Compared with healthy control group, there were significant rise in serum UA level[(342.4±101.7) μmol/L vs.(459.6±110.3) μmol/L]and incidence rate of hyperuricemia (33.33% vs.58.16%) in CPHD group, P<0.05 both;along with NYHA class increased, there were significant rise in serum UA level[(350.7±103.4) μmol/L vs.(422.3±106.7) μmol/L vs.(491.8±113.2) μmol/L], LVEDd [(59.2±10.1)mm vs.(64.3±9.8)mm vs.(68.9±10.6)mm], and significant reduction in LVEF[(37.7±9.8)% vs.(31.9±8.6)% vs.(28.4±8.1)%]in CPHD patients, P<0.05 all;linear correlation analysis indicated that serum UA level was significant positively correlated with LVEDd (r=0.67, P=0.026), and significant inversely correlated with LVEF (r=-0.86, P=0.033).Conclusion: Serum uric acid level can be used as a reliable index evaluating heart failure severity in patients with chronic pulmonary heart disease.
3.One case report of SAPHO syndrome and literature review
Journal of Peking University(Health Sciences) 2003;0(06):-
To study the clinical features and diagnosis of synovitis,acne,pustulosis,hyperostosis,osteitis syndrome(SAPHO) syndrome.One case of SAPHO syndrome was reported and the related data of SAPHO syndrome were reviewed.The main clinical features of the patient were articulatio carpi synovitis,acne,cervical rib hyperostosis,articulatio sternoclavicularis and osteitis,So the diagnosis of SAPHO syndrome was made.Though SAPHO syndrome is rare with yet unknown prevalence,it still can be seen in clinical practice,and can be diagnosed by careful examination.
5.Acupuncture and tuina clinical thoughts of "treating the back from abdomen" for low back pain.
Chinese Acupuncture & Moxibustion 2015;35(7):715-717
In clinical treatment, it is found that certain patients always have some positive reaction points those are relevant with low back pain in the abdomen area. When the simple treatment on the low back is ineffective, the efficacy could be significantly improved if acupuncture or tuina is performed at the abdomen areas, which is called "regulating yin to treat yang", or "treating the back from abdomen". In this paper, with the diagnosis and treatment method of "treating the back from abdomen" for low back pain as principal line, the detailed manipulation is explained for low back pain that is induced by TCM meridian diseases or modern anatomy, which could open the methods for clinical treatment of low back pain and enrich the therapeutic options.

6.Progress on exosomal transmission of microRNAs in cancer research
Chinese Journal of Clinical Oncology 2016;43(10):442-445
Exosomes are cell-derived vesicles that contain protein and RNA from the same source and function. The vesicle has a diam-eter between 30 and 100 nm. Exosomes are the natural carriers and have been recently used as drug delivery system for cancer treat-ment. MicroRNAs (miRNAs) function in RNA silencing and regulation of gene expression. They can exist as intracellular and extracellu-lar miRNAs. Extracellular miRNAs can function as secreted signaling molecules that affect receptor cell phenotype. They can also re-flect molecular changes in donor cells. Therefore, extracellular miRNAs can be potentially used for diagnosis and therapeutics. Studies show that the volume of exosomes in cancer patients' blood is higher than that in normal controls. The ability to package cancer-relat-ed miRNAs is a biological function of exosomes. In conclusion, specific miRNAs transferred by exosomes may play an important role in the pathogenesis of tumor or cancer. This paper presents a summary of research on exosomes as the carrier of miRNAs in the develop-ment and treatment of cancer.
7.Current progress of the prevalence of albuminuria and its influencing factors
Chinese Journal of Laboratory Medicine 2014;37(12):973-976
Currently the detection of albumin excretion rate is widely used to screen early renal injury.In recent years,there are many researches about the prevalence of albuminuria in the general population around the world,showing the high prevalence of albuminuria in the general population,and indicating that the increased albumin in urine is significantly correlated with obesity,abnormal lipid metabolism,abnormal glucose metabolism,hypertension and life habits.Meanwhile,numerous studies find that albuminuria is an independent risk factor for the progression and risk evaluation of cardiovascular disease and all-cause mortality,it can be a useful predictor of cardiovascular mortality and all-cause mortality in the general population.
8.Curcumin prevents against osteoarthritis
Chinese Journal of Tissue Engineering Research 2015;(2):277-282
BACKGROUND:Curcumin is proved to possess anti-inflammatory, antioxidant and anti-apoptotic roles. OBJECTIVE: To summarize and discuss the mechanisms and effects of curcumin used for the treatment of osteoarthritis METHODS: PubMed, Embase, Elseveir databases were retrieved for relevant articles published from 1973 to 2014, with the key words of “osteoarthritis, curcumin, chondrocyte, articular cartilage” in English. After the quality of the included studies was evaluated, valid data were extracted and analyzed.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ION:Curcumin prevents the occurrence and development osteoarthritis by inhibiting oxidative enzyme and scavenging free radicals. Curcumin increases production of colagen type 2 through suppressing the reduction of cartilage matrix by matrix metaloproteinases. Anti-inflammatory reaction of curcumin can be achieved by inhibiting cytosolic phospholipase A2, cyclooxygenase-2, and 5-lipoxygenase. Curcumin inhibits interleukin-1β-induced apoptosis of chondrocytes and mitochondrial sweling. Results from clinical trials suggest that curcumin or its derivatives can reduce joint pain and improve the function of knee joints in patients with osteoarthritis. High-concentration curcuminin vitro have been demonstrated toxic effects.
9.Clinical application of foldable multifocal intraocular lens
Academic Journal of Second Military Medical University 2000;0(07):-
The implantation of the foldable multifocal intraocular lens,a new pseudophakia intraocular substitute,needs only a small incision and the post-operative complications are rare.The incoming light can be refracted into several fo-cuses.Improved visual acuities both for far and near distance are obtained,which downregulated the glasses-wearing rate.This article summarizes the theories and designs,implantation,clinical application,theropeutic outcomes,and complications of this type of multifocal intraocular lens.
10.New achievement in the studies of opioid participation in the regulation of cardiovascular system
Chinese Pharmacological Bulletin 1986;0(04):-
The recent research of opioid receptors has achieved great progress, especially in the field of the protection of cardiac muscles in ischemic preconditioning, which makes people pay more attention to the relation ship between opioid receptors and cardiovascular system. This article summarizes the studies of opioid receptors, the measures they take to modulate cardiovascular system and the way they participate in ischemic proconditioning both at home and abroad.
